A step-by-step guide to decoding the brain and nervous system for students and healthcare professionals.
What you'll learn
Neural cell biology: neurons, glial cells, and their functions.
Electrical properties of neurons: potentials, conduction, and synaptic transmission.
Functional and structural neuroanatomy: sensory, motor, and autonomic systems.
Peripheral and central neurological disorders: myopathy, neuropathy, radiculopathy, myelopathy.
Neurodevelopment and neurodevelopmental disorders.
Neurological diagnostic methods and neuropathology basics.
Analyze and interpret neurological syndromes by linking symptoms to underlying neuroanatomical structures.
Explain the mechanisms of neural signaling including resting, graded, and action potentials, and their clinical relevance.
Apply diagnostic reasoning using neurological tests and neuropathology principles to identify disorders.
Integrate knowledge of neurodevelopment to understand developmental disorders and their impact on function
Evaluate the role of neurotransmitters and synapses in normal brain function and neurological diseases.
Requirements
Basic understanding of biology and physiology.
No prior neurology experience required.
Description
This course offers a comprehensive journey into the fascinating world of neurology, designed to take learners from foundational concepts to advanced understanding of the nervous system. It begins by introducing the essential building blocks of neurology, including the structure and function of neural cells and the basic principles of neuroanatomy. From there, it gradually expands into the intricate organization of the nervous system, exploring both structural and functional aspects that govern sensory, motor, and autonomic processes.As the course progresses, learners will dive deep into the mechanisms of neural signaling, uncovering how neurons generate and transmit electrical impulses through resting, graded, and action potentials. The role of synapses and neurotransmitters in communication between neurons is examined in detail, along with the processes that enable neuroplasticity and adaptability within the nervous system. These insights are paired with an exploration of neurodevelopment, providing a clear understanding of how the nervous system forms and how developmental disorders can impact its function.The course also emphasizes clinical application, guiding learners through the recognition and interpretation of neurological syndromes. It covers disorders affecting both peripheral and central systems, such as myopathy, neuropathy, radiculopathy, myelopathy, and conditions involving the cerebellum, brainstem, and cerebral cortex. Each topic is connected to practical diagnostic approaches, including neurological tests and neuropathology fundamentals, ensuring that learners can apply theoretical knowledge to real-world scenarios.By the end of this course, participants will have a solid grasp of how the nervous system operates, how its components interact, and how dysfunction manifests in clinical practice. This structured, in-depth program is ideal for medical students, healthcare professionals, and anyone eager to understand the complexities of neurology in a clear, systematic way. It combines scientific rigor with practical insights, making it a valuable resource for both academic learning and professional development.By the end of this course, you will:Understand the structure and function of neural cells and their role in signaling.Master functional and structural neuroanatomy.Learn the mechanisms of neuron potentials, synapses, and neurotransmitters.Explore neurological syndromes affecting peripheral and central systems.Gain insights into diagnostic methods and neuropathology.
Who this course is for
Medical students and residents preparing for neurology rotations.
Healthcare professionals seeking a refresher in neuroanatomy and neurophysiology.
Neuroscience enthusiasts who want a structured, comprehensive learning experience.
